AS LEVEL PE


AS Physical Education - OCR

Candidates will study;

Unit G451 - An introduction to Physical Education

Unit G452 - Acquiring, developing and evaluating practical skills in PE

Unit G454 - The improvement of effective performance and the critical evaluation of practical activities in PE.

 

Unit G451 - An introduction to Physical Education

Anatomy and Physiology (Section A)
• The skeletal and muscular systems
• Motion and movement
• The cardiovascular and respiratory systems in relation to the performance of physical activity
 

Acquiring Movement Skills (Section B)
• Classification of motor skills and abilities
• The development of motor skills
• Information processing
• Motor control of skills in physical activity
• Learning skills in physical activity
 

Socio-Cultural Studies relating to participation in physical activity (Section C)
• Physical activity
• Sport and culture
• Contemporary sporting issues

 

Unit G452 - Acquiring, developing and evaluating practical skills in PE

* Performance
• Evaluating and planning for the improvement of performance
